1235UMFL - Unidentified



1235UMFL.jpg


Reconstruction of Victim by Samantha Steinberg
Date of Discovery: December 24, 1986
Location of Discovery: Miami, Miami-Dade County, Florida
Estimated Date of Death: Hours
State of Remains: Recognizable face
Cause of Death: Injuries due to massive blunt trauma

Physical Description

Estimated Age: 30-45 years old
Race: Black
Sex: Male
Height: 5'2"
Weight: 126 lbs.
Hair: Black
Eye Color: Brown
Distinguishing Marks/Features: Mustache; Wire sutures over the right parietal area of the skull. Craniotomy, well healed.

Identifiers

Dentals: Available
Fingerprints: Available
DNA: Not available.

Clothing & Personal Items

Clothing: Unknown
Jewelry: Unknown
Additional Personal Items: Unknown

Circumstances of Discovery

The deceased, a pedestrian, was attempting to cross the Palmetto Expressway and was struck by a car.
The deceased was given first aid on the scene and then transferred to Jackson Memorial Hospital where he was pronounced expired.
